Moscow Middle School cleared by bomb threat
A note claiming a bomb was in a locker canceled classes Tuesday at Moscow Middle School, though police quickly determined the threat was a hoax.
Moscow Police Chief David Duke said a 14-year-old male student brought the threatening note to the school office about 10:45 a.m., saying he found it in a bathroom. The same student later indicated to investigating police officers that he had written the note himself, Duke said.
Classes at the school are scheduled to resume today as usual.
Students and staff members were evacuated to designated "safe zones" at adjacent football and baseball fields shortly before 11 a.m. Tuesday, Duke said.
District administrators then made the decision to move students to the high school, where parents could pick them up, Superintendent Greg Bailey said.
The parents of the student suspected of writing the note were contacted, Duke said, and the student was turned over to them.
The police department will forward its report to Latah County Youth Services. Whether the student is charged with a crime will be up to youth services and the Latah County prosecutor.
Bailey said the district usually waits until a police investigation is complete in such instances before determining school consequences for the student.
"We would look at our discipline policies in place and consider the safety issue," Bailey said. "It can lead to anything from suspension (to) expulsion."
Canceling school isn't taken lightly, Bailey said, but buses already were moving by the time law enforcement officers determined there was no danger Tuesday.
"I feel like staff did their jobs, and we did everything we could to assure the safety of our students," he said.
Bailey said he doesn't think the school will have to make up the missed day, but that decision will be up to the school board. A snow day is built into the district's schedule, and the state has a policy for emergency closures.
Before Tuesday, the last bomb threat in the district was in December 2014, when a penciled message was found in a boys' bathroom at Moscow High School. The perpetrator of that threat was never caught. The most recent bomb threat in Moscow schools before that was in 2009.
